Crepe Myrtle trimming services involve carefully shaping and maintaining these vibrant flowering trees to ensure they remain healthy and attractive. The work typ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out overgrown areas, and pruning to promote better air circulation and sunlight penetration. Proper trimming encourages more abundant blooms and helps the tree develop a balanced form, which can enhance the overall appearance of a property. Skilled service providers understand the best techniques to preserve the tree’s natural shape while preventing potential issues caused by improper pruning.
Regular trimming of Crepe Myrtles can help address common problems such as branch breakage, uneven growth, and pest infestations. Overgrown or poorly maintained trees may develop weak or crossing branches that can pose safety hazards or damage nearby structures. Additionally, excessive growth can make trees more susceptible to disease or insect problems. By keeping the trees well-pruned, homeowners can reduce the risk of these issues and maintain a healthy, safe landscape. The overview below groups typical Crepe Myrtle Trimming proj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Williamsburg,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Trimming - Typical costs for routine crepe myrtle pruning range from $150-$400 for many standard jobs. Most residential projects fall within this middle range, covering annual or bi-annual maintenance. Larger, more detailed trims may push costs higher but are less common.
Moderate Shaping - For more extensive shaping or thinning, local contractors often charge between $400-$900. These projects involve significant branch removal or aesthetic adjustments and are less frequent than routine trims.
Large Pruning or Removal - Larger, more complex projects like extensive pruning or partial removal can range from $900-$2,500. Many jobs in this tier are for older or overgrown trees requiring specialized equipment and skills.
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a crepe myrtle typically costs $1,500-$5,000+, depending on size and site conditions. These projects are less common and usually involve significant logistical planning by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why should I consider trimming my Crepe Myrtle? Trimming helps maintain the tree's shape, promotes healthy growth, and can enhance its flowering potential in Williamsburg and nearby areas.
When is the best time to have a Crepe Myrtle trimmed? The ideal time for trimming is typically in late winter or early spring before new growth begins, according to local horticultural practices.
What types of trimming services do local contractors offer for Crepe Myrtles? Service providers can perform crown thinning, shaping, dead branch removal, and overall health maintenance tailored to the needs of Crepe Myrtles.
